Abstract

The purpose of this study is to compare the effects of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R) and Corporate Governance (CG) on Corporate Resilience (CR) during the first and second waves of COVID-19 in Indonesia and Malaysia. Data for this study were collected from companies listed on the IDX80 of the Indonesia Stock Exchange and the FTSE Bursa Malaysia 100 of the Bursa Malaysia. STATA 14.2 was used for data analysis. The results indicate that in Indonesia, Environmental Disclosure, Social Disclosure, Board of Directors Size, and Audit Committee Size have a significant effect on CR, but not Economic Disclosure and Board of Commissioners Size. In Malaysia, only the size of the Audit Committee has a significant effect on the CR. On the other hand, during the second wave of the pandemic in 2021, CSR and CG did not significantly impact CR for Indonesia and Malaysia. This study shows that internal factors such as CSR and GC do not affect investors' decisions to buy stocks during pandemics. Future research should consider including additional variables, not limited to internal factors, but external factors such as inflation rate and interest rate. Future researchers may need to further combine financial and non-financial data to examine if these factors influence investor decisions to buy stocks during pandemics.
